多齿差摆线泵滑动系数的研究

摘    要:根据齿轮的啮合原理及传动中各位置矢量和速度矢量之间的关系,导出了多齿差摆线齿轮传动中各速度和齿面滑动系数的矢量计算式;并结合实例进行了运动速度和滑动系数的计算和曲线绘制,分析了齿廓的相对滑动速度和滑动系数的变化规律,为正确设计多齿差摆线齿轮提供了理论依据。

关 键 词:多齿差摆线泵  相对运动  滑动系数  齿轮传动

On the Sliding Coefficient of the Cycloidal Pump with Multi-tooth Number Difference

Abstract:Based on the meshing theory and gear geometry relationship of position and velocity vector,the velocity and the sliding coefficient formulas of cycloidal pump with multi-tooth umber difference were deduced theoretically.The related velocity and sliding coefficient variation curves were made by calculated examples and the change trend of relative sliding velocity and sliding coefficient were analyzed.It provides theoretical evidence for design of the cycloidal pump.
Keywords:Cycloidal pump with multi-tooth number  Relative moment  Sliding coefficient  Gear transimission
